BOONE, N.C. -
Appalachian State University women's outdoor track and field will compete in 13
meets in its 2013 campaign, announced by head coach John Weaver on Wednesday afternoon.
The Mountaineers will start its season on the road as they
travel to Conway, S.C. for the Coastal Carolina Invitational on Friday, Mar. 8
and Saturday, Mar. 9.
The Apps will stay on the road as they compete in the Wake
Forest Invitational on Friday, Mar. 15 and Saturday, Mar. 16 and the High Point
Invitational in High Point, N.C. on Saturday, Mar. 23.
App State will host its first of two meets on Saturday, Mar.
30 when teams travel to Boone for the Mountains vs. Beaches meet to conclude
its March schedule.
The Black and Gold will kick off April when they travel to
Auburn, Ala. on Friday Apr. 5 and Saturday, Apr. 6 for the Auburn Invitational.
The Mountaineers will return to High Country for one last
meet on Friday, Apr. 12 for the Appalachian Invitational.
Weaver and his team will travel to Statesboro, Ga. to
compete for its third straight Southern Conference title on Saturday Apr. 20
and Sunday, Apr. 21 in the SoCon Outdoor Championships.
Appalachian will stay on the road as they travel to
Philadelphia, Pa. for the Penn Relays on Thursday, Apr. 25 through Saturday,
Apr. 27 and then to Clemson, S.C. for the Clemson Invitational on Saturday,
May. 4. The Apps will turn around and travel straight to Raleigh, N.C. for the
NCSU Last Chance meet on Sunday, May 5.
The Apps will compete in its last regular season meet when
they travel to Atlanta, Ga. for the Georgia Tech Invitational on Friday, May 10
and Saturday, May 11.
Qualifiers of the NCAA Preliminaries will compete in
Greensboro, N.C. from Thursday, May 23 through Saturday, May 25 in hopes of
traveling to the NCAA Division 1 Championships in Eugene, Or. on Wednesday,
June 5 through Saturday, June 8.
